Guerrilla made it very hard for themselves. Everybody remembers the first footage showed (I think it was the E3 2005 footage) that was intended to promote the PS3 as an incredible console. First they said it was completely in-game footage, later on they had to admit that it was CGI. So everybody is expecting a game that looks like the CGI-movie. The graphics are still pretty good for current-gen. But they overhyped the game, making people dissappointed about what they get to see now. It will probably be a good game no doubt, but like BB King sings 'the thrill is gone'.
